Does Clear Eyes Preservative Free drops contain antihistamine?

I contacted the company and asked them if their Clear Eyes Pure Relief Multi Symptom Preservative Free eye drops had antihistamine (which I cannot take). There answer was "4/4/2017 "We like to advise you that the product contains the following ingredients phenylephrine hydrochloride, glycerin, hypromellose, citric acid, purified water, sodium chloride, and sodium citrate. We have no indication of whether or not the product contains antihistamine."
For them to say they don't know whether or not it contains antihistamine sounds very "stupid" to me. They are the manufacturer of this product. I would say they should know.
Does anyone know if these eyes drops contain antihistamine?

That being said there are no antihistamines in Pure.  Many preservative medications will now be coming out in bottles. Preservatives prevent bacterial grown or stabilize drugs. Some people are allergic to them. Without preservatives bacteria/virus can enter and grow. In eye drops when the bottle is squeeze then release it creates suction that pulls some drops from the outside back into the bottle. The new technology prevents bacteria or virus from entering the bottle. Samples of Pure drops are hard to get but many of our patients like them a lot.
